Twenty-three novice workers commence their customs endeavors at the primary customs office in Schweinfurt.
The Main Customs Office Schweinfurt recently welcomed 23 new recruits into the civil service on September 2, 2025. These young individuals have embarked on a journey towards a secure future in a large federal administration, as part of the customs service.
In principle, customs takes on all suitable trainees, offering high-quality training or studies and a variety of exciting tasks. The theoretical training in the middle service takes place at the customs' own training centre in Erfurt, while the higher service trainees complete their theoretical parts at the Federal Administration Academy in Münster.
During their practical phases, the trainees will spend time in various departments of the training customs office and at nearby customs offices, gaining hands-on experience in a wide range of customs-related tasks. This can include casework, special units, tax control, and customs investigation.
The new recruits are undergoing training: 17 in the middle service for a duration of two years, and 6 in the higher service for three years. Upon completion, the trainees can expect to be assigned to various tasks within customs. The middle service training qualifies for the professional title of "financial administrator".
